2021 Outbreak of Norovirus Associated with a Caterer, Tennessee
In January 2021, public health investigators in Tennessee investigated an outbreak of suspected norovirus associated with catered food. Seven people were ill. No one was hospitalized and no one died.
The vehicle of transmission was not reported.
